How they compare
Portugal currently reports 176,486 number against 166,910 number in Oman, a difference of 9,576 number.
That makes Portugal's figure about 1.1 times Oman's.
Across all 23 years both countries report, Portugal has been ahead every year.
Oman ranks 94th and Portugal ranks 93rd of 194 countries.
Portugal has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Oman | Portugal |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 55,950 number | 237,064 number | 181,114 number | Portugal |
| 2000s | 75,025 number | 192,168 number | 117,143 number | Portugal |
| 2010s | 83,732 number | 183,458 number | 99,727 number | Portugal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
